A serverless architecture is a way to build and run applications and services without having to manage infrastructure. Your application still runs on servers, but all the server management is done by AWS. You do not need to provision, scale, and maintain servers to run your applications, databases, and storage systems.

Services Offered
  • Using Lambda, run your code without provisioning or managing servers
  • Using S3, store and retrieve any amount of data, anytime, anywhere on the web.
  • Amazon DynamoDB is a fully managed NoSQL database service that provides fast and predictable performance with seamless scalability. You can scale up or scale down your tables’ throughput capacity without downtime or performance degradation.
  • Using Amazon Simple Notification Service (Amazon SNS) that is a web service which lets you coordinate and manage the delivery or sending of messages to subscribing endpoints or clients.
Key Features:
  • Platform independent: We can use any third party libraries and packages or any code as a lambda layer to manage and share them easily across multiple functions.
  • Built-in fault tolerance: AWS lambda maintains compute capacity across multiple AZs in each region to protect your code against individual machine or data center facility failures, there are no maintenance windows or scheduled downtimes.
  • Storage Classes: Amazon S3, you can store data across a range of different storage classes, which moves data one storage class to another for cost savings.
  • Auto Scaling: DynamoDB scales tables to adjust for capacity and maintains performance with zero administration.
  • Message Encryption: Amazon SNS provides encrypted topics to protect your messages from unauthorized and anonymous access.

AWS provides several security capabilities and services to increase privacy and control network access. These include: Network firewalls built into Amazon VPC, and web application firewall capabilities in AWS WAF (Web Application Firewall), which lets you create private networks, and control access to your instances and applications.
An advantage of the AWS cloud is that it allows you to scale and innovate, while maintaining a secure environment. You only pay for the services you use.you can have the security you need, without the upfront expenses, and at a lower cost than in an on-premises environment.

Automation is a broad term that refers to the processes and tools an organization uses to reduce the manual efforts associated with provisioning and managing cloud computing workloads. IT teams can apply cloud automation to private, public and hybrid cloud environments. automate your IT and run scheduled tasks with high availability. It allows you to easily automate your IT processes so you can focus on improving your business strategy.

Services Offered:
  • AWS CloudFormation: AWS CloudFormation is a service that helps you model and set-up your Amazon Web Services resources so that you can spend less time managing those resources and more time focusing on your applications that run in AWS.
  • Terraform: Terraform is a free and third-party tool, it allows you to create, manage, and update your infrastructure in a safe and efficient manner. Terraform can manage includes low-level components such as compute instances, storage, and networking, as well as high-level components such as DNS entries, SaaS features.
    The configuration file described in Terraform can create a single application or the entire data center. Terraform even generates an execution plan before creating the actual infrastructure and configuration changes. Terraform is capable of updating the infrastructure with the new changes made to it.
Key Features:
  • Safety Controls: Specify the CloudWatch alarm that CloudFormation should monitor during the stack creation and update process. If any of the alarms are breached, CloudFormation rolls back the entire stack operation to a previous deployed state.
  • Preview Changes to your Environment: AWS CloudFormation makes the changes to your stack.
  • Dependency Management: No need to worry about specifying the order in which resources are created, updated, or deleted. CloudFormation determines the correct sequence of actions to use for each resource when performing stack operations.
  • Infrastructure as a code: We can use code to provision and deploy servers and applications.
  • Change Automation: Complex change sets can be applied to your infrastructure with minimal human interaction.

DevOps focuses on automating everything that allows for small chunks of code to be written, tested, monitored and deployed in hours, not weeks or months. This eliminates writing large chunks of code that takes weeks to deploy.

As smaller to mid-size enterprises continue to integrate DevOps strategies into their daily workloads, they can turn to certain technologies to propel or boost their successful adoption.

Role of AWS in DevOps: AWS Developer is responsible for designing, deploying, and developing cloud applications on the platform. Design, manage, and maintain tools to automate operational processes.

Services Offered:
  • Continuous Integration: Developers regularly merge their code changes into a central repository, after which automated builds and tests are run
  • Continuous delivery: Is a software development practice where code changes are automatically prepared for a release to production.
  • Microservices: The microservices architecture is a design approach to build a single application as a set of small services. Each service runs in its own process and communicates with other services through a well-defined interface using a lightweight mechanism, typically an HTTP-based application programming interface (API).
  • Infrastructure as Code: Infrastructure is provisioned and managed using code and software development techniques, such as version control and continuous integration.
Key Features:
  • Provides Collaboration: collaboration between product managers, developers, and operations professionals.
  • Continuous Build: Code Build is a fully managed build service that compiles source code, runs tests, and produces software packages that are ready to deploy.
  • Continuous Testing and Continuous Delivery.
